Common use of Where the Association Clause in Contracts

Where the Association. requests a secondment for a teacher who is elected to Provincial Executive Council, as the President of a local, or other local official already named in the collective agreement, the teacher shall be seconded on a scheduled basis up to a maximum of the teacher's FTE provided that the amount of FTE the teacher is seconded is mutually agreed to by the School Division, the teacher, and the Association and is at no cost to the School Division. 13.5. During such secondment, the School Division shall maintain the teacher's regular salary, applicable allowances, and any benefit contributions required by the collective agreement and make the statutory contributions on the teacher's behalf. The Association shall reimburse the School Division for all payments made by the School Division to the teacher or on the teacher's behalf while on secondment under this clause.
